History & Origin
Audry is a spelling of Audrey — from the Old English Aethelthryth, 'noble strength' (aethel, 'noble', + thryth, 'strength'). A crisp, classic name (said 'AW-dree').
In the U.S. it appears as a spelling of Audrey. Rare in this form, noble-strength at the root, and crisp.
